How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 40229?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
40229 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,185 | $899 | $2,279 |
40229 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,377 | $950 | $2,339 |
40229 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,591 | $1,250 | $2,561 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ly the 40229 ZIP Code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ly 40229 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in 40229 is $1,233.
What is the largest Pet Friendly 40229 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in 40229 is a 1,465 square feet unit starting from $1,000 at Village at Gateway.
What is the average size for 40229 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in 40229 is currently at 626 sq ft.
